What is ADHD?

Before diving into the online testing process, let's briefly discuss what ADHD is. ADHD is identified by a pattern of negligence, hyperactivity, and impulsivity that disrupts operating or advancement. Here are some common symptoms connected with ADHD:

Symptom TypeCommon Symptoms
InattentionProblem staying focused, reckless mistakes, difficulty organizing tasks
HyperactivityFidgeting, difficulty remaining seated, extreme talking
ImpulsivityDisrupting others, difficulty waiting on turns, making decisions without thinking about effects

ADHD can manifest in numerous forms, resulting in 3 subtypes:

  1. Predominantly Inattentive Presentation: Inattention is primary.
  2. Predominantly Hyperactive-Impulsive Presentation: Hyperactivity and impulsivity are predominant.
  3. Combined Presentation: Both neglectful and hyperactive-impulsive symptoms are present.

Importance of Testing

Understanding whether a person has ADHD can cause better management of the condition through suitable interventions and support systems. An ADHD test can help measure symptoms and supply a clearer image when looking for diagnoses.

Benefits of the Online ADHD Test

Online testing for ADHD is a practical alternative that provides various benefits:

  1. Accessibility: Available at any time and from any location, testing can be performed in the comfort and personal privacy of one's home.
  2. Anonymity: Individuals can take the test without fear of judgment or stigma.
  3. Cost-Effective: Most online tests are free or come at a low cost compared to in-person assessments.
  4. Immediate Results: Some tests provide instant feedback, allowing people to understand their symptoms much better in a brief time frame.
  5. Boosted Awareness: The online test can result in increased understanding and understanding of ADHD, motivating individuals to seek further help if needed.

The Online ADHD Testing Process

In the UK, various online platforms offer ADHD tests. Here's a three-step introduction of how the procedure generally works:

Step 1: Selecting a Test

People can start by choosing a suitable online test tailored for ADHD assessment. Lots of tests intend to evaluate different aspects of attention, impulse control, and hyperactivity. Here are some well-respected tests offered:

Test NameDescription
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S)A questionnaire designed for adults to self-assess ADHD symptoms.
Conners Adult ADHD Rating ScalesUsed for recognizing symptoms and figuring out intensity in adults.
Brown Attention-Deficit Disorder ScalesProcedures the performance of attention abilities and helps assess ADHD.

Step 2: Completing the Questionnaire

During this step, people address a series of concerns regarding their behavior and attention-related symptoms. Typical questions may include:

  • Do you frequently discover it difficult to focus on tasks?
  • Are you easily sidetracked by external stimuli?
  • Do you often forget everyday tasks and obligations?

Step 3: Interpreting Results

Upon conclusion, the test usually produces a rating showing the likelihood of ADHD presence. While these results can be informative, they are not a conclusive medical diagnosis. If ADHD is suggested, users are encouraged to consult a certified health care expert for further evaluation.

What to Do After the Test

Receiving an indication of ADHD after taking an online test can be a pivotal minute for numerous individuals. Here are a couple of actions to consider:

  1. Consult a Professional: Schedule a visit with a doctor concentrating on ADHD for an official assessment.
  2. Gather Further Information: Research more about ADHD and its treatment options, including therapy, medication, or lifestyle changes.
  3. Seek Support: Consider signing up with support system or forums to get in touch with others experiencing comparable obstacles.

F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ION: Frequently Asked Questions

1. Are online ADHD tests accurate?

Online ADHD tests can provide important insights however ought to not be used as a sole diagnostic tool. They can highlight possible symptoms but need to be followed up with professional assessment.

2. Who should take an ADHD test?

Anyone who suspects they might have ADHD or has actually experienced symptoms of inattention or hyperactivity throughout their life should think about taking an online test. It can be beneficial for adults who were not detected in youth but suspect they have the condition.

3. How long do online ADHD tests take?

The majority of online tests take around 10 to 20 minutes to complete, depending on the variety of questions asked.

4. What happens if the test shows high possibility of ADHD?

If the test results suggest a high likelihood of ADHD, it's suggested to get in touch with a healthcare specialist for a detailed assessment and explore possible treatment choices.

5. Is there an expense associated with these online tests?

While lots of online ADHD tests are free, some may charge a charge for additional services or thorough evaluations. It is important to check out the terms before accessing the tests.
